Output 6ffa627ac68cfe6b7b78ea083353fc94c2a2196521fed66b085929ce06d8d19b:7

value
126270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0359f2a1cf465e71f4cfa0ead7f92379d0af7128 OP_EQUAL
address
31zjhoPhrJJXo2zcyQ1CMmZXtgBwwChSQj
transaction
6ffa627ac68cfe6b7b78ea083353fc94c2a2196521fed66b085929ce06d8d19b
spent
true